***This Artwork was a Finalist in the Whitewall Art Prize***

‘When We Were One (Divine Union) is a visual journey into our connectedness of being, painted by Sydney intuitive artist Leni Kae.

“Often as humans we are instilled with a belief that our existence and experiences are individual and isolated, which can translate to emotional or spiritual disconnection. Here, I wanted to shine a light on the commonalities of our experiences from the moment we are born; connected in our experience of growth, thought, emotion, dream, energy. They are shared and rippled all around us. Acknowledging this connectedness is not just important for our own health and personal development, but vital for the health and spiritual growth of the collective.” – Leni Kae (c) @LeniKae

From Leni Kae’s series “Awakenings”
